Where the Christmas presents come from?

An idea for a short animation (and later multimedia) project. Made as a group work.

There is a planet far away in another galaxy, called "Ballywood". The planet is shaped as a gift - it is not around but just a big cube. This is the place where the habitants called bally´s - or balls - are formed and given birth by their mother, the planet itself, every year when the time is right. In this certain time new balls come out from a volcano and very soon are sent to another planets, mostly to the Earth. These balls can travel through space by bally-rays and simply land to the Earth and visit different houses and families. They are the future presents. So after they find the right family, they come to the house an evening before Christmas and turn into a present that the child or family member wishes to get. The only purpose of bally´s lives is to find the right family and then be the present till the end of their life. This is their greatest pleasure and wish to make good for others. They never turn to their home planet again - only as a spirit that connects again to their mother and formes a new body to be born. This is how the bally planet Ballywood lives, in the wish of making good to others at the time Christmas is coming. Every year new balles are formed and sent to be the gifts for people.
